I have a valid SSL certificate that is verified through the AddTrust External
Root Certificate that is not being verified properly by the TortoiseHG install.
I am not sure why this is happening. The site is
https://www.thinking-man.com/repo/ . You can clearly see that it is valid and
that it has been verified.

Things I have done.

I exported the root certificate and verified that is was located in the
C:\Program Files\TortoiseHg\hgrc.d\cacert.pem. The root certificate is stored
there as AddTrust External Root.

Every time I try to push or pull I get the Error: SSL: Server certificate
verify failed
